Understanding Exponential Growth

Exponential wealth generation begins with the power of compound interest, a mechanism where returns produce further returns. Unlike simple linear gains that add a fixed amount each period, compound interest accelerates growth as earnings themselves begin to generate profits.

Adopt Exponential Thinking

Most savers default to fixed-income assets offering 4–5% returns, but shifting your mindset unlocks far greater results. Embrace strategies that aim for double-digit returns by reallocating a significant portion of your portfolio into equities and high-growth ventures.

When you shift from linear thinking to exponential mindsets, your portfolio has the potential to double every seven years at a 10% return rate. Over 30 years, that can mean turning $100,000 into $1.6 million rather than $400,000.

Master Debt Management and Leverage

Not all debt is detrimental. High-interest obligations, like credit cards, should be eliminated immediately, while low-interest loans can be leveraged to invest in higher-yield assets.

By strategically borrowing against mortgages or taking margin loans at rates below expected returns, you can use other people’s money to amplify your compounding effect. Always maintain prudent risk controls and avoid overextending your obligations.

Remember to pay off high-interest debt immediately and preserve capacity for low-cost leverage where it makes sense.

Save Aggressively and Automate

Your saving rate directly impacts the fuel you have for compounding. Aim to set aside at least 20% of your gross income, directing contributions first to retirement accounts, then to taxable investment vehicles.

Automate every step, from debt repayment to investment deposits, ensuring that human error or procrastination never interrupts your growth trajectory.

Balance and Protect Your Portfolio

Even the best growth strategies require balance. Diversify across asset classes—equities, bonds, commodities, currencies—and periodically rebalance to lock in gains and maintain risk targets.

By mix diverse assets that don't correlate, you smooth the ride and prevent drawdowns from derailing your compounding engine.
